RED SQUARE ON A BLACKBOARD takes us into the heart of the 2012 student crisis to experience from the inside one of the most important social movements in Quebec history. In cinema verité style, the camera stays with the members of the largest student organisation, the CLASSE, as the crisis unfolds. We follow Maxime, Victoria and Justin, as well as the two official spokespersons Gabriel and Jeanne through the dramatic ups and downs of the strike.
We have privileged access behind the scenes to experience with them the intense public debate that raged for weeks during the Maple Spring (Printemp érable).
